A novel cable bacteria species with a distinct morphology and genomic potential

ABSTRACT Cable bacteria form a group of multicellular prokaryotes that enable electron transfer over centimeter-scale distances within marine and freshwater sediments. To this end, the periplasm of these filamentous bacteria contains specialized conductive fibers, which extend along the full length...
